In the first week of September, there was a noticeable increase in the prices of various dairy and poultry products, including rabbits, with a slight rise in the prices of Grana cheeses, butter, and fats. The market saw stable demand for Parmesan Reggiano Dop and Padano cheeses, but a downward trend in the prices of breeding piglets. Rabbit prices saw a significant increase due to scant supply, while chicken prices remained stable. Egg prices also saw improvement due to increased demand from the processing industry and consumers. The wholesale market saw a slight recovery in the average price lists of extra virgin olive oil, while the prices for virgin and lampante olive oil remained stable. The wholesale market prices for refined olive and pomace products also remained stable, with minor changes in the prices of sunflower oil. The national market for common wines in August remained stable, with no significant changes reported.
